Overview
Explore the concept of embodiment in this comprehensive IEEE session, delving into its fundamental principles and applications. Gain insights into how physical form and sensorimotor interactions shape cognitive processes and artificial intelligence. Discover the latest research and theories surrounding embodied cognition, and its implications for robotics, human-computer interaction, and cognitive science. Engage with expert discussions on the role of the body in shaping perception, decision-making, and learning in both biological and artificial systems.
